ODELL, TODD E (SWBT) wrote: > I just recently got my mod_perl to work. Config is > mod_perl-1.27/Apache-1.3.26 on AIX 4.3.3. > > I wrote a PerlAuthenHandler which uses Expect.pm, requiring the normal > Symbol.pm. In my startup.pl script for mod_perl I had this line: > use lib qw(/usr/opt/perl5/lib/site_perl/5.6.1/aix/Apache); > I get a "bareword" error when IO:Handle tries to call the gensym(Symbol.pm) > BUT if I comment the above line out it seems to get past that. I see that > there is an Apache::Symbol which looks quite different than the 'normal' > one. > My question is by letting the normal Symbol.pm load, so IO:Handle will work, > is that going to mess things up since the Apache::Symbol is different? Or > will everything be able to know which to use? eh? why in the world you are trying to do that? there is no /usr/opt/perl5/lib/site_perl/5.6.1/aix/Apache, there is /usr/opt/perl5/lib/site_perl/5.6.1/aix. Of course you will have problems when you load the wrong package. It's Apache::Symbol, not Symbol in the dir Apache/. __________________________________________________________________ Stas Bekman JAm_pH ------> Just Another mod_perl Hacker http://stason.org/ mod_perl Guide ---> http://perl.apache.org m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ED] http://use.perl.org http://apacheweek.com http://modperlbook.org http://apache.org http://ticketmaster.com
